October 24 2018 Presented by Jeff Vukovich A Eyth B Henderson C Jang US EPA OAQPS C Allen J Beidler K Talgo CSRAGDIT Goal Support a northern hemispheric CMAQ run for year 2016 using the latest available emissions data to better understand hemispheric transport of biogenic and anthropogenic pollutants.
